Memorial Hermann Health System Job Summary
The position is responsible for setting and driving the strategies and primary outcomes including learning, change and professional role competencies and growth. The role provides leadership and direction for onboarding, orientation, competency management, education, role development and collaborative partnerships. As an administrator, this role is responsible for overseeing the planning, implementation and evaluation of overall clinical education and professional development within assigned facilities and across the system. The position collaborates with leadership to develop and implement strategies for meeting the clinical education and professional development needs relating to health care services. Position is responsible for providing leadership, direction and support for one or more clinical education departments, ensuring the delivery of quality education programs; Implements programs and establishes strategic vision for respective campuses or entities in alignment with System goals. Typically reports to AVP, System Clinical Education. M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S
Education:
Bachelor’s degree in Nursing required. Master’s degree in related field required. Licenses/Certifications:
Registered Nurse (RN) license required; Nursing Specialty Certification, required (can include Nursing Professional Development (NPD)). Experience / Knowledge / Skills: Two (2) years nursing experience required Five (5) years' experience in nursing clinical education and professional development environment required Five (5) years' experience in a formal management role required Effective oral and written communication skills Principal Accountabilities
Directs the daily and strategic clinical education operations for assigned Memorial Hermann facilities. Reviews and approves all new hires, establishes and controls standards for performance appraisals; works with managers to identify staffing needs and provides for accordingly. Works with service line leaders and managers to establish clinical education goals and strategic plan. Stays up-to-date on new developments in the field. Reviews departmental policies, procedures, and systems. Administers departmental budget and reviews financial records on expenditures. Provides leadership in curriculum design, instructional delivery, accreditation, and learning assessments. Evaluates program performance and ensures that all related federal, state and regulatory requirements are met. Advocates for organizational support of ongoing development for all healthcare staff. Oversees the development of clinical education and training quality evaluation tools. Interfaces with leadership and staff throughout the system in addressing training and education needs of employees. Participates in the development of a Continuous Quality Improvement program for all levels of employees. Coordinates developmental methodologies from not only a hospital but a system perspective. Directs the development and implementation of clinical education and training programs for all clinical staff. Fosters collaborative partnerships to set goals, resolve problems, and make decisions that enhance organizational effectiveness and outcomes. Builds external relationships with vendors and community partners as appropriate. Provides leadership support for department-based goals which contribute to the success of the organization. Ensures safe care to patients, staff and visitors; adheres to all Memorial Hermann policies, procedures, and standards within budgetary specifications including time management, supply management, productivity and quality of service. Promotes individual professional growth and development by meeting requirements for mandatory/continuing education and skills competency; supports department-based goals which contribute to the success of the organization; serves as a resource to less experienced staff. Demonstrates commitment to caring for every member of our community by creating compassionate and personalized experiences. Models Memorial Hermann’s service standards of providing safe, caring, personalized and efficient experiences to patients and our workforce. Other duties as assigned. Seniority level
